 Understanding Pricing Models for One-on-One Calisthenics Coaching in Houston, USA

 

When seeking personalized guidance in calisthenics in Houston, Texas, understanding how coaches structure their pricing is essential for budgeting and choosing the right fit. Unlike standardized gym memberships, one-on-one coaching involves a direct exchange of a specialized service for a fee. Here’s a detailed breakdown of the common pricing models you’ll encounter for one-on-one calisthenics coaching in Houston and across the US:

 

  1. Hourly Rate:

 

 Description: This is the most straightforward and prevalent pricing model. Coaches charge a fixed rate for each hour (or sometimes a fraction of an hour, like 30 or 45 minutes) of dedicated one-on-one training time.

 Factors Influencing the Rate: As discussed previously, the hourly rate is influenced by the coach’s experience, certifications, specialization, reputation, location within Houston (cost of living), and the training venue.

 Pros: Offers flexibility. You pay only for the time you train. It’s easy to understand and budget for individual sessions.

 Cons: Can become expensive if you train frequently. May not incentivize long-term commitment as much as packages.

 

  1. Package Deals (Block Sessions):

 

 Description: Coaches often offer discounted rates when clients purchase a block of sessions upfront (e.g., 5, 10, 20 sessions). This encourages commitment and provides a more predictable income stream for the coach.

 Discount Structure: The discount percentage typically increases with the number of sessions purchased. A 5-session package might have a smaller discount than a 20-session package.

 Pros: Lower per-session cost compared to individual bookings. Incentivizes consistency and long-term training. Can provide a more structured training plan.

 Cons: Requires a larger upfront investment. You might lose money if you can’t complete all the sessions within the specified timeframe (some packages have expiration dates).

 

  1. Monthly Retainers:

 

 Description: This model involves a fixed monthly fee for a predetermined number of training sessions per month, often combined with other services like personalized program design, check-ins, and communication outside of sessions.

 Structure: Retainers can vary in the number and duration of sessions included, as well as the additional support offered. Higher-tier retainers usually include more sessions and more comprehensive services.

 Pros: Predictable monthly cost. Often includes more than just the training sessions themselves, fostering a more holistic coaching relationship. Can provide greater accountability and support.

 Cons: You pay the same fee each month regardless of whether you use all the included sessions. Might be less flexible than hourly rates if your schedule varies significantly.

 

  1. Hybrid Models (Combination Pricing):

 

 Description: Some coaches in Houston might combine elements of different pricing models. For example, they might charge an hourly rate for individual sessions but offer discounted packages or monthly retainers for clients who commit to a certain frequency.

 Flexibility: This allows for more tailored pricing based on the client’s needs and commitment level.

 

  1. Performance-Based Pricing (Less Common):

 

 Description: In rare cases, a coach might structure their fees based on the client achieving specific calisthenics skills or fitness goals within a defined timeframe. This model is less common due to the variability of individual progress.

 Risk and Reward: Can be highly motivating but also carries risk for both the client and the coach.

 

Factors to Consider When Evaluating Pricing Models in Houston:

 

 Your Budget: Determine how much you can realistically afford to invest in calisthenics coaching on a per-session and monthly basis.

 Your Commitment Level: If you’re highly committed to long-term training, packages or retainers might offer better value. If your schedule is unpredictable, hourly rates might be more suitable.

 Your Training Needs: If you need a lot of guidance, frequent sessions might be necessary, influencing the overall cost. If you’re more independent, less frequent check-ins might suffice.

 The Coach’s Value Proposition: Consider what you’re getting for the price. A more experienced coach with specialized skills might justify a higher rate.

 Trial Sessions or Consultations: Many coaches in Houston offer trial sessions or free consultations. This allows you to experience their coaching style and discuss their pricing models before committing.

 

Negotiation (Use with Caution):

 

While some coaches might be open to slight adjustments, especially for long-term commitments or referrals, aggressive negotiation can sometimes devalue the coach’s expertise and time. It’s generally best to understand their pricing structure upfront and choose a coach whose rates align with your budget.
